Grindhouse is our transcoding farm. Jobs land in the intake bucket, workers claim via lease, output goes to the mezzanine tier. Don't restart workers mid-segment; let the lease expire. Scaling is manual — bump WORKER_COUNT and redeploy. Logs rotate daily; anything older than a week is gone. If ffprobe chokes on an input, quarantine it, don't retry. All config lives in /etc/grindhouse/farm.env and workers read it at boot only. The shared token that authorizes workers against the job broker belongs on the following line.

vault entry, kahip-fahog: RELAY_SECRET20=6a2c791de808f35c3b55

The key used to sign flag-rollout manifests was rotated per the quarterly schedule. All Flagwright control-plane nodes in the Ostermere cluster have been updated; edge evaluators will pick up the new key on their next sync, typically within ten minutes. Rollouts signed with the retired key will fail validation after Friday's cutoff, so re-sign any staged manifests before then. The rotation was verified against both canary rings with no evaluation drift. The replacement signing key follows.

signing key of bagap-yawep = bky13_TbfT6ZMUoGJo2

Subject: Capacity call — Norwick plant

Hi all — quick update for branch managers before Friday. We've decided to add a second shift at the Norwick factory rather than contract out to Fellgrave Manufacturing. Cost runs a bit higher short-term, but quality stays in-house and lead times drop to nine days by spring. Hiring starts next month; Tomas owns the ramp plan. Branches should keep promising current delivery windows until we confirm the new ones. There's one strategic point you need to hold close.

confidential, fajop-fawep: Gilionek Holdings plans to raise the Norwyn list price by 23.4 percent in May. The board signed off on a budget of $292.3 million for Project Fenwyn. The renewal with Jorwynox Group closes at $289.1 million a year, 59.5 percent above the last contract. Project Wenox slips by one quarter because of the audit delay.